BGP map for 2602:ff16:15::/48
2602:ff16:15::/48 is announced by AS29802 HIVELOCITY, Inc. and seen by 330 peers of 23 RIPE RIS collectors, over 242 different AS paths. Its busiest upstreams are AS174 Cogent Communications, LLC (62%) and AS12213 Centersquare (38%). The most common path, used by 11 peers, is AS24482 AS6461 AS12213 AS29802.
